Ah, Kakadu National Park – a slice of Australian wilderness that’ll leave you spellbound! Picture this: you’re cruising out of Darwin in the crisp morning air, anticipation building as you head towards one of the most extraordinary landscapes on Earth.

As you delve into this [full-day sightseeing tour](https://www.musement.com/us/darwin/kakadu-national-park-full-day-sightseeing-tour-in-darwin-330159/), you’ll find yourself transported to a world where ancient art meets untamed nature. The star of the show? Ubirr Rock, where you’ll stretch your legs and marvel at Aboriginal rock art that’s been telling stories for millennia. It’s like stepping into a time machine, folks!

But Kakadu isn’t just about what’s etched in stone. The park pulsates with life, from the crocs lurking in billabongs to the chorus of birdsong in the air. You might even spot a wallaby or two if you’re lucky!

One of the tour’s hidden gems is the [Guluyambi Cultural Cruise](https://www.kakadutoursandtravel.com.au/). Here, you’re not just a passive observer – you’re invited into the heart of Indigenous culture. The local guides share stories that’ll make you see the landscape through entirely new eyes.

What sets this tour apart is its intimacy. [Small group sizes](https://www.getyourguide.com/darwin-l357/from-darwin-kakadu-national-park-full-day-tour-t399334/) mean you’re not just another face in the crowd. You’ll have plenty of chances to chat with your guide, ask questions, and really soak in the experience.

And let’s talk comfort – you’ll be whisked around in an air-conditioned minibus, because let’s face it, the Top End can be a tad warm! It’s the perfect blend of adventure and ease.

By the time you’re heading back to Darwin, you’ll be filled with a sense of wonder and connection to this ancient land. It’s more than just a day trip; it’s a journey through time and culture that’ll stick with you long after you’ve returned home.
